在当今的数字化时代,服务器作为企业信息系统的核心组件,其性能直接影响到业务的连续性、用户体验以及运营成本,定期查看并分析服务器性能成为IT运维人员的重要职责之一,本文将深入探讨如何有效地查看和评估服务器性能,包括关键指标、使用的工具及方法,以及提升性能的策略建议。
一、为何要查看服务器性能?
1、预防故障:通过监控可以提前发现潜在问题,避免宕机或服务中断。
2、优化资源分配:合理调配CPU、内存、存储等资源,提高整体效率。
3、容量规划:为未来的扩展提供数据支持,确保系统能够应对业务增长。
4、成本控制:识别并消除资源浪费,降低不必要的开支。
5、用户体验保障:快速响应用户请求,提升满意度和忠诚度。
二、关键性能指标(KPIs)
1、CPU使用率:反映处理器的工作负载情况,高持续使用率可能意味着需要优化代码或增加处理能力。
2、内存使用率:过高的内存占用会导致系统变慢甚至崩溃,需关注是否有内存泄漏问题。
3、磁盘I/O:包括读写速度和延迟,影响数据访问效率和应用程序响应时间。
4、网络吞吐量:衡量数据传输速率,对于依赖网络通信的应用尤为重要。
5、并发连接数:显示同时处理的请求数量,过多可能导致过载。
6、响应时间:从用户发起请求到接收到响应所需的时间,直接关联用户体验。
7、错误率:记录系统错误和异常情况,帮助定位问题根源。
三、查看服务器性能的工具
1、操作系统自带工具:如Windows的任务管理器、Linux的top/htop命令,提供基本的系统资源使用情况。
2、专业监控软件:如Nagios、Zabbix、Prometheus等,支持更详细的监控和报警功能。
3、云服务提供商的控制台:AWS CloudWatch、Azure Monitor、Google Cloud Monitoring等,专为云环境设计,集成度高。
4、应用性能管理(APM)工具:如New Relic、Dynatrace,专注于应用层面的性能分析。
5、日志分析工具:ELK Stack(Elasticsearch, Logstash, Kibana),用于收集和可视化日志数据,辅助性能诊断。
四、实施有效的性能监控策略
1、设定阈值警报:为关键指标设置合理的阈值,并在超出时触发警报,以便及时响应。
2、定期审查与调整:随着业务发展和技术进步,定期回顾监控策略,适时调整监控项和阈值。
3、自动化监控:利用脚本或自动化工具实现定期检查和报告生成,减少人工干预。
4、趋势分析:长期跟踪性能数据,通过图表等形式分析趋势,预测未来需求。
5、跨团队协作:确保运维、开发、业务团队之间的沟通顺畅,共同参与性能优化过程。
五、提升服务器性能的策略
1、代码优化:优化算法和数据结构,减少不必要的计算和内存占用。
2、硬件升级:根据监控结果,适时增加CPU、内存或采用更快的存储解决方案。
3、负载均衡:分散流量至多台服务器,避免单点过载。
4、缓存机制:合理使用内存缓存、Redis等技术,减轻数据库压力。
5、数据库优化:索引优化、查询优化、分库分表等手段提升数据库性能。
6、CDN加速:对静态资源使用内容分发网络,加快全球访问速度。
查看服务器性能是一个持续的过程,它要求IT团队不仅要有合适的工具和方法,还需要建立一套完善的监控体系和应急响应机制,通过不断的监测、分析和调整,可以有效保障服务器的稳定运行,支撑业务的持续发展。
随着互联网的普及和信息技术的飞速发展台湾vps云服务器邮件,电子邮件已经成为企业和个人日常沟通的重要工具。然而,传统的邮件服务在安全性、稳定性和可扩展性方面存在一定的局限性。为台湾vps云服务器邮件了满足用户对高效、安全、稳定的邮件服务的需求,台湾VPS云服务器邮件服务应运而生。本文将对台湾VPS云服务器邮件服务进行详细介绍,分析其优势和应用案例,并为用户提供如何选择合适的台湾VPS云服务器邮件服务的参考建议。
工作时间:8:00-18:00
电子邮件
1968656499@qq.com
扫码二维码
获取最新动态